## =========================================================================
## Insert Credentials, SQL Server Details & SMTP server Details
## =========================================================================
$server = '.database.windows.net' # Set the name of the server
$jobDB = '' # Set the name of the job database you wish to test
$user = '' # Set the login username you wish to use
$passw = '' # Set the login password you wish to use
$FromEmail = '[email protected]' # "from" field's account must match the smtp server domain
$FromEmailPassw = '' # use app/server access token - it works with account passw
$ToEmail = '[email protected]'
$SMTPServer = "smtp.mail.yahoo.com" #insert SMTP server
$SMTPPort = "587" # or port 465
$StorageAccountName = ''
$StorageContainerName = ''
## =========================================================================
## Section to mask credentials during remote sessions
## =========================================================================
## To mask user credentials during remote sessions, uncomment below code section
## and password will be asked during execution. This approach is not recomended for automation tasks.
<#
$credentials = Get-Credential -Message "Credentials to test connections to the database (optional)"
$user = $credentials.GetNetworkCredential().username
$passw = $credentials.GetNetworkCredential().password
#>
$todaydate = Get-Date -Format yyyyMMddTHHmmssffff
$output_file = "failed_jobs_$todaydate.log"
$FormatEnumerationLimit = -1
if (Test-Path $output_file) {
Remove-Item $output_file
}
$params = @{
'serverInstance' = $server
'database' = $jobDB
'username' = $user
'password' = $passw
'outputSqlErrors' = $true
}
Invoke-SqlCmd @params
$params.query = "SELECT * FROM jobs.job_executions WHERE lifecycle = 'Failed' ORDER BY start_time DESC"
Invoke-SqlCmd @params | Format-Table -Wrap -Autosize | out-File -filepath $output_file
if((Get-Content $output_file).Length -ne 0)
{
'Failed Jobs Found. Sending email...'
function Send-ToEmail([string]$email){
$message = new-object Net.Mail.MailMessage;
$message.From = $FromEmail;
$message.To.Add($email);
$message.Subject = "Alert Notification - ElasticJob Failed";
$time = Get-Date
$message.Body = @"
##############################################
ALERT NOTIFICATION
##############################################
Note: You are receiving this email because Failed Elastic Jobs were identified for your database.
Issue: Elastic Job Failed
Description: The attached file contains a list with Failed Jobs for below resource:
Subscription ID: $((Get-AzContext).Subscription.id)
Impacted Database: $($params.database)
On Server: $($params.serverInstance)
File generated at $($time.ToUniversalTime()) UTC time.
"@
$att = new-object Net.Mail.Attachment($output_file)
$message.Attachments.Add($output_file)
$smtp = new-object Net.Mail.SmtpClient($SMTPServer, $SMTPPort);
$smtp.EnableSSL = $true;
$smtp.Credentials = New-Object System.Net.NetworkCredential($FromEmail, $FromEmailPassw);
$smtp.send($message);
$att.Dispose()
write-host "=====================" ;
write-host " Mail Sent" ;
write-host "=====================" ;
}
Send-ToEmail -email $ToEmail;
}else{
'No failed jobs.'
}
## =========================================================================
## Login when running from a Runbook
## =========================================================================
## Enable this code section when running from Azure Runbook
## Get the connection "AzureRunAsConnection" when run from automation account
<#
$connection = Get-AutomationConnection -Name AzureRunAsConnection
Connect-AzAccount `
-ServicePrincipal `
-Tenant $connection.TenantID `
-ApplicationId $connection.ApplicationID `
-CertificateThumbprint $connection.CertificateThumbprint
"Login successful.."
#>
# Get key to storage account
$acctKey = (Get-AzStorageAccountKey -Name generals -ResourceGroupName general).Value[0]
# Map to the reports BLOB context
$storageContext = New-AzStorageContext -StorageAccountName $StorageAccountName -StorageAccountKey $acctKey
# Copy the file to the storage account
Set-AzStorageBlobContent -File $output_file -Container StorageContainerName -BlobType "Block" -Context $storageContext -Verbose
